The character "题" derives its etymology from the phonetic element "是" combined with the semantic component "页", which originally pertained to the head, thus giving the character its initial meaning of the forehead. This connection to the foremost part of the body facilitated a metaphorical shift towards denoting the title or heading of a written work, as it similarly occupies a prominent position at the beginning. Structurally, the traditional form "題" preserves these components distinctly, while the simplified form "题" maintains the same constituent parts with a modified graphic representation. Over time, the semantic scope of "题" expanded to encompass the act of inscribing or writing upon a surface, and eventually broadened further to refer to any subject matter, question, or problem presented for discussion or solution.
